San Juan Triangle
has about 400,000 public visits/year and is badly in need of public
funding. For 400,000 visits 5 toilets (bring
plastic bag & wipes ), also needs road
improvements, interpretive signs, building restoration, mining site
historical restoration, parking spaces. Many historic buildings are in bad shape and
need funding to stabilize or will collapse. Now the Federal BLM can
accept your donation for the San Juan Triangle.
